FUNCTIONAL DESCRIPTION
Selectable spread spectrum and modulation rates
The PLL701-10 provides selectable multiplier factors (1x to 8X), selectable spread spectrum modulation, as well as
selectable modulation rate. Selection is made by connecting specific input pins to a logical “zero” or “one”. Pins 6
(SC0), 7 (SC1), 8 (SC2) and 12 (SC3) are used as inputs to select the spread spectrum modulation as shown on
the spread spectrum selection table (page 2). Pins 3 (M2), 4 (M1), 5 (M0) are used as inputs to select the output
frequency as shown on the output clock selection table (page 1). Pin 11 is the output enable pin, that tri-states all
outputs when low (logical “zero”).
In order to reduce the number of pins on the chip, the PLL701-10 uses pin 2 and 14 (XOUT/SD0 and REF/SD1) as
a bi-directional pin. The pins serve as modulation rate selector inputs (SD0 and SD1) upon power-up (see
modulation rate table on page 1), and as XOUT crystal connection (pin 2), and REF output signal (pin 14) as soon
as the inputs have been latched.
Connecting a selection pin to a logical “one”
All selection pins have an internal pull-up resistor (30k
Ω for pins 3, 4, 5, 6, 7, 8, 11, 12, 14 and 120kΩ for pin 2).
This internal pull-up resistor will pull the input value to a logical “one” (pull-up) by default, i.e. when no resistive
load is connected between the pin and GND. No external pull-up resistor is therefore required for connecting a
logical “one” upon power-up.
Connecting a selection pin to a logical “zero”
For an input only pin, i.e. all input pins except XOUT/SD0 (pin 2) and REF/SD1 (pin 14), the pin simply needs to be
grounded to pull the input down to a logical “zero”. Connecting the bi-directional pins (SD0 and SD1) to a logical
“zero” will however require the use of an external loading resistor between the pin and GND that has to be
sufficiently small (compared to the internal pull-up resistor) so that the pin voltage be pulled below 0.8V (logical
“zero”). In order to avoid loading effects when the pin serves as output, the value of the external pull-down resistor
should however be kept as large as possible. In general, it is recommended to use an external resistor of around
Rup/4 (e.g. 27k
Ω for pin 2 and 4.7kΩ for pin 14, see Application Diagram).
